What to Expect
Bring structure to complex data and shape the future of digital rehabilitation.
Caspar Health is the digital rehabilitation clinic with the vision of giving every patient access to the most effective rehabilitation treatment anywhere at any time. We provide individual, digital therapy combined with personal care from therapeutic healthcare professionals.
To elevate our data infrastructure and product analytics capabilities, we are expanding our Data Analytics! In this role, you are much more than a traditional BI analyst - you act as the central bridge between business, product, and tech teams. You turn ambiguous requests into well-defined data models, pioneer AI-supported workflows and help build our analytical foundation from the ground up.
Your Challenges
Problem Framing & Alignment: Translating ambiguous business, product, or operational requests into clear metrics, decision-ready problems and actionable recommendations
Product Analytics Foundations: Designing reusable domain models, semantic logic, data sources, and KPI definitions from scratch
Decision-Ready Dashboards: Building focused, reliable data visualisations in Tableau to support business-critical processes and decisions
AI & Workflow Automation: Designing and piloting AI-supported workflows (using tools like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or, or n8n) to streamline analysis, coding and QA processes
Stakeholder Partnership: Challenging assumptions constructively while acting as a project-managing bridge between product, sales, and operations teams
Data Quality & Governance: Resolving complex analytical data, source-system and business-logic issues at their root cause within a regulated health-tech setup
Your Profile
Professional Experience: 3+ years of hands-on experience as a Data Analyst, Product Analyst, Analytics Engineer, or in a similar analytical role
SQL Expertise: Strong practical proficiency in SQL and familiarity with modern data stacks (Snowflake or dbt preferred)
Data Visualisation: Proven track record in designing clear, decision-ready dashboards and metric frameworks (Tableau preferred)
AI Tooling & Automation: Active experience or strong openness toward leveraging AI productivity tools (e.g.,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or) to optimize analytical workflows
Stakeholder Translation: Excellent communication skills to explain findings, limitations, and recommendations to both technical and non-technical audiences
Structured Thinking & Ownership: Independent problem-solver comfortable navigating ambiguity, driving projects to completion, and upholding high data quality standards
